Founded in 1893 Dublin Central Mission is part of the Methodist Church in Ireland, committed to expressing the Christian Faith in our capital city. Approximately 2,500 attend the church in Lr. Abbey St. every week and a key feature is the many self-help groups that use the premises on an ongoing basis.  Rev. John Stephens is the Minister there and he told Eileen Good about this time of year in the Church.
